A shop in Co Mayo got more than it bargained for, when an otter entered the store, running around the aisles.

Staff at the Mr Price store in Swinford tried to shepherd the animal to safety, while a wildlife expert was called in.

The otter was eventually caught, and is being looked after by the expert.

Store manager Cathy Nolan said: "The expert, who runs a wildlife charity has since got back to us to let us know the otter has a chest infection and a temperature and was also close to starvation, she is now nursing him back to health with all her other animals."
